The ‘Unseen Community’ exhibit at the People’s History Museum, is a selection of LGBT+ pare
nts and carer images of their family.  This project was developed in 2019 but had to postponed due to COVID. We look forward to seeing lots of our families at the launch. But if you can’t make it you can still visit the exhibit as it will be open from July - September 2021 in their engine room.

The Anna Freud organisation (The National centre for children and families) is looking for early years dads and adoptive parents who can help to develop a Parent Platform for online mental health support.

The platform will include videos, podcasts, training, Q&As and opportunities to speak to other early years dads and adoptive parents. For some of these projects, they are planning to provide a gift voucher of £10 at M&S for every hour of service.

They want to develop the Parent Platform with the people who will use it. Getting involved can range from completing a one-off survey, to sharing your thoughts and experiences at each stage of development. To learn more please review and complete their expression of interest form (https://forms.office.com/r/Mq5aziq9kt).

Join us over on our Proud 2 b Parents Social Facebook group for a Parent Support Session with Emma from Everyday’s a School day. Emma will be covering everything you need to know about getting our little ones ready for starting school in September. Emma says ‘The leap to starting Primary School is a big one and it can feel scary for grown ups and children alike’. 
In this reassuring session Emma will chat through the key skills children need for school, what to worry about and what to chill out about! She will cover what sort of information you should expect from school and how to get organised for those first few weeks and months of doing the school run!
